Accelerate security investigations with Kiro CLI
In the face of security incidents in Amazon Web Services (AWS), quick response is essential, yet many security teams find themselves hampered by lengthy manual processes. Analysts are burdened with the need to memorize intricate AWS Command Line Interface (AWS CLI) syntax and to manually integrate data from various security tools such as Amazon GuardDuty and AWS CloudTrail. This complexity can hinder efficient investigations and response efforts during critical events.
